DevSecOps Engineer

4 months ago


Vienna, United States MicroHealth, LLC Full time
Job DescriptionJob DescriptionMicroHealth is seeking a DevSecOps Engineer to support our client and team in Vienna, VA. The DevSecOps Engineer will play a key role in ensuring the security, reliability, and efficiency of our development and deployment processes. 

THIS IS A PLANNED POSITION

Overview: As a DevSecOps Engineer, you will be responsible for implementing and maintaining robust security measures throughout our software development lifecycle.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ate security practices seamlessly into our DevOps processes, ensuring the delivery of secure and high-quality software products/services.  
Responsibilities: 
  • Implement security best practices within DevOps workflows to ensure secure software development, testing, and deployment. 
  • Collaborate with development and operations teams to design, build, and maintain secure CI/CD pipelines. 
  • Conduct security assessments, vulnerability scanning, and penetration testing to identify and mitigate risks in applications and infrastructure. 
  • Automate security controls and compliance checks using tools like Ansible, Puppet, or Chef. 
  • Develop and maintain infrastructure as code (IaC) using tools such as Terraform or CloudFormation. 
  • Monitor and respond to security incidents, conduct root cause analysis, and implement corrective measures. 
  • Work closely with teams to enforce security policies, standards, and procedures. 
  • Stay updated on em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and industry best practices to enhance security measures proactively. 
Requirements: 
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field (or equivalent work experience). 
  • 3-5 years of experience in DevOps, with a focus on security (DevSecOps). 
  • Proficiency in scripting languages such as Python, Bash, or PowerShell. 
  • Experience with CI/CD tools (Jenkins, GitLab CI/CD, CircleCI, etc.) and version control systems (Git). 
  • Knowledge of c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es). 
  • Familiarity with security tools like IDS/IPS, WAF, vulnerability scanners, and SIEM solutions. 
  • Strong understanding of security protocols, encryption techniques, and secure coding practices. 
  • Certifications such as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H),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P), or similar are a plus. 
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and ability to work in a fast-paced environment. 
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.
